What Does a Health Insurance Agent in Stoughton Cost?

Health insurance agents in Massachusetts typically do not charge a separate fee for their services. They are paid by insurance carriers through commissions that are built into the plan premiums. For individual plans, monthly premiums can range from around 300 to 800 dollars for a single adult depending on age, income, and plan type. Subsidies through the Health Connector can lower these costs significantly. This is general information and not insurance advice.

Frequently Asked Questions

What does a health insurance agent in Stoughton do?
A health insurance agent helps you compare plans from different carriers, explains coverage details, and assists with enrollment. They can also help you understand subsidies available through the Massachusetts Health Connector. Agents in Massachusetts must be licensed by the state Division of Insurance.
How do I choose a health insurance agent in Stoughton?
Look for an agent who is licensed in Massachusetts and has experience with both private plans and the Health Connector. You can verify a license through the Massachusetts Division of Insurance website. Ask about their familiarity with local hospitals and doctors in the Stoughton area.
When can I enroll in health insurance in Massachusetts?
Open enrollment for individual plans typically runs from November 1 to January 23 each year. You may qualify for a special enrollment period if you have a qualifying life event like losing other coverage, moving, or having a baby. Massachusetts has a year-round enrollment period for MassHealth and subsidized plans.
